Output 679df7629a719b22d343654dfbec464f33b2795885cea172923af3ab87a33b02:8

value
602860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9501d96541d9fa611f612b84c7eb1718d99ba4 OP_EQUAL
address
3Mi4QkvBQJRiDP9tWToGDydrwiMhuENvLE
transaction
679df7629a719b22d343654dfbec464f33b2795885cea172923af3ab87a33b02
confirmations
362143
spent
true